Python Plugin Management, simplified
Project description
Library under development. Contains rough edges/unfinished functionality. API subject to changes.
Installation
pip install pluginmanager
-or-
pip install git+https://github.com/benhoff/pluginmanager.git
Quickstart
from pluginmanager import PluginInterface plugin_interface = PluginInterface() plugin_interface.set_plugin_directories('my/fancy/plugin/path') plugin_interface.collect_plugins() plugins = plugin_interface.get_instances()
Custom Plugins
The quickstart will only work if you subclass IPlugin for your custom plugins.
import pluginmanager class MyCustomPlugin(pluginmanager.IPlugin): def __init__(self): self.name = 'custom_name' super().__init__()
Or register your class as subclass of IPlugin.
import pluginmanager pluginmanager.IPlugin.register(YourClassHere)
Add Plugins Manually
Add classes.
import pluginmanager plugin_interface = pluginmanager.PluginInterface() plugin_interface.add_plugins(YourCustomClassHere) plugins = plugin_interface.get_instances()
Alternatively, add instances.
import pluginmanager plugin_interface = pluginmanager.PluginInterface() plugin_interface.add_plugins(your_instance_here) plugins = plugin_interface.get_instances()
pluginmanager is defaulted to automatically instantiate unique instances.
Disable automatic instantiation.
import pluginmanager plugin_interface = pluginmanager.PluginInterface() plugin_manager = plugin_interface.plugin_manager plugin_manager.instantiate_classes = False
Disable uniquness (Only one instance of class per pluginmanager)
import pluginmanager plugin_interface = pluginmanager.PluginInterface() plugin_manager = plugin_interface.plugin_manager plugin_manager.unique_instances = False
Filter Instances
Pass in a class to get back just the instances of a class
import pluginmanager plugin_interface = pluginmanager.PluginInterface() plugin_interface.set_plugin_directories('my/fancy/plugin/path') plugin_interface.collect_plugins() all_instances_of_class = plugin_interface.get_instances(MyPluginClass)
Alternatively, create and pass in your own custom filters.
def custom_filter(plugins): result = [] for plugin in plugins: if plugin.name == 'interesting name': result.append(plugin) return result filtered_plugins = plugin_interface.get_instances(custom_filter) class FilterWithState(object): def __init__(self, name): self.stored_name = name def __call__(self, plugins): result = [] for plugin in plugins: if plugin.name == self.stored_name: result.append(plugin) return result
Architecture
pluginmanager was designed to be as extensible as possible while also being easy to use. There are three layers of access.
- Interfaces:
public facing
- Managers:
extended or replaced
- Filters:
implementation specific
Interface
An interface was used to provide a simple programmer interface while maintaining the ability to separate out the concerns of the implementation. The main interface is the PluginInterface. PluginInterface is designed to be as stateless as possible, and have interjectable options where applicable.
Managers
There are four managers which make up the core of the library.
- DirectoryManager:
Maintains directory state. Responsbile for recursively searching through directories
- FileManager:
Can maintain filepath state. Does maintain file filter state. Responsible for applying file filters to filepaths passed gotten from directories
- ModuleManager:
Loads modules from source code. Keeps track of loaded modules. Maintains module filter state. Responsible for applying module filters to modules to get out plugins.
- PluginManager:
Instantiates plugins. Maintains plugin state.
Filters
Filters are designed to offer implementation-level extensiblity. Want to only return only files start with “plugin”? Create a filter for it. Or use some of the provided filters to provide the desired implementation.
All filters are callable.
